Events
- January 23 - The Principality of Liechtenstein is created within the Holy Roman Empire
- April 25 - Daniel Defoe publishes Robinson Crusoe
Births
Deaths
- January 12 - John Flamsteed, astronomer
- November 8 - Michel Rolle, mathematician
